MyBlogLog Adds Support for Adding Your Contacts to Your Existing Address Book
Friday, April 25th, 2008From the MyBlogLog Blog (try saying that one 3 times fast) — MyBlogLog hCard & vCard: More Microformats, More Portable Data. They are supporting the hCard format as well as the vCard format to enable you to download contact details directly to your address book. NikNik has more analysis over at MyTechOpinion.

RealEstate.com Adds Google Street View
Monday, April 21st, 2008RealBird was 1st out of the gate integrating Google Street View imagery back in March. Trulia announced their Google Street view integration a week later. Today, RealEstate.com announces their integration.
I’m sensing a growing trend…

Embedding Imagery on Single Property Websites
Wednesday, January 30th, 2008In short, I think embedding Google Street View imagery into a single property website is a great idea. Zoltan at RealBird has a writeup that shows how to embed street view imagery into a RealBird single property site.
Or you can use MyMarketWare to integrate “Bird’s Eye View” imagery from Pictometry.
